Product: HP Pavilion All-in-One - 22-a113w (Touch)
Operating System: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)
Hp Pavilion a113w all-in-one
Touch Screen quit working after latest Microsoft Update. Tried uninstalling Display Touch Screen Driver, restarted.
That worked on sign in, but quit working main screen. Reinstalled Driver, Restarted. Touch worked on sign in,
stopped again main screen. Later worked again but quit.
Installed latest update ending in 23. Touch worked but quit .
Uninstalled last 3 updates. Restarted. Uninstalled Touch Screen Restarted. Touch not working.
Reinstalled 2 of last 3 updates. Touch not working.
